CVE-2023-46141 describes an Incorrect Permission Assignment for Critical Resource vulnerability impacting multiple PHOENIX CONTACT classic line products. This flaw allows a remote, unauthenticated attacker to gain full control of affected devices. With a CVSS score of 9.8 (CRITICAL), it presents a high-severity risk due to its network-based attack vector, low complexity, and complete comp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. Currently, there is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ion surrounding this vulnerability.
